Fully managed library providing five types of heap. It implements d-ary, binary, binomial, Fibonacci and pairing heaps, in order to let the user choose the best heap to fit her needs. Each heap has its own advantages and disadvantages: please see the documentation or Wikipedia to better understand how those data structures work and how they behave in each operation.
NOTICE: If you need more performance, please have a look at the Hippie.Unchecked package. It is a release where all integrity checks have been stripped away.
See the version list below for details.
Install-Package Hippie -Version 1.5.0
dotnet add package Hippie --version 1.5.0
<PackageReference Include="Hippie" Version="1.5.0" />
paket add Hippie --version 1.5.0
* Added thin heaps, which are fast and efficient but offer less operations than raw, unique and multi heaps.
* Reworked internal structure and external interfaces.
This package is not used by any popular GitHub repositories.